I've got a buddy who does insurance and I asked him about a quote on a little Skater recently. Came back with under $800 per year. Seems like the guys going ape on the cat insurance are the guys looking to jump into a 36' Skater as their first boat. Not that insurance isn't high for the big cats, but boat size, value and prior cat experience are critical.
